我有一个应用程序,其中包含目前是PNG的图标。我正在尝试创建矢量图像,但我似乎无法找到任何好的教程。 有一些指向这个http://templarian.com/2011/08/06/tutorial_creating_an_icon/ 但这只是将文件导出为png。
我在网上看到的图标与我想要的xaml格式相同
<DrawingImage x:Key="RestoreIcon">
<DrawingImage.Drawing>
<DrawingGroup>
<DrawingGroup.Children>
<GeometryDrawing Brush="#FFFFFFFF" Geometry="F1 M 898.726,800.022L 913.274,800.022L 913.274,804.022L 918.607,804.022L 918.607,815.978L 904.06,815.978L 904.06,811.978L 898.726,811.978L 898.726,800.022 Z M 913.274,811.978L 906.57,811.978L 906.57,813.278L 915.964,813.278L 915.964,807.909L 913.274,807.909L 913.274,811.978 Z M 901.237,803.908L 901.237,809.278L 904.06,809.278L 904.06,804.022L 910.631,804.022L 910.631,803.909L 901.237,803.908 Z M 910.631,809.278L 910.631,807.909L 906.57,807.908L 906.57,809.278L 910.631,809.278 Z ">
<GeometryDrawing.Pen>
<Pen Thickness="1" LineJoin="Round" Brush="#C7141414"/>
</GeometryDrawing.Pen>
</GeometryDrawing>
</DrawingGroup.Children>
</DrawingGroup>
</DrawingImage.Drawing>
</DrawingImage>
这是从GeometryDrawing信息中绘制一个图标。我正在寻找如何制作自己的GeometryDrawing数据?
理想情况下,我希望能够导入我的png图像,绘制它的顶点并获取GeometryDrawing数据。